module DFHack
class << self
# return an Unit
# with no arg, return currently selected unit in df UI ('v' or 'k' menu)
# with numeric arg, search unit by unit.id
# with an argument that respond to x/y/z (eg cursor), find first unit at this position
def unit_find(what=:selected)
if what == :selected
case ui.main.mode
when :ViewUnits
# nobody selected => idx == 0
v = world.units.active[ui_selected_unit]
v if v and v.pos.z == cursor.z
when :LookAround
k = ui_look_list.items[ui_look_cursor]
k.unit if k.type == :Unit
else
raise "bad UI mode #{ui.main.mode.inspect}"
end
elsif what.kind_of?(Integer)
world.units.all.binsearch(what)
elsif what.respond_to?(:x) or what.respond_to?(:pos)
world.units.all.find { |u| same_pos?(what, u) }
else
raise "what what?"
end
end
# returns an Array of all units that are current fort citizen (dwarves, on map, not hostile)
def unit_citizens
race = ui.race_id
civ = ui.civ_id
world.units.active.find_all { |u|
u.race == race and u.civ_id == civ and !u.flags1.dead and !u.flags1.merchant and
!u.flags1.diplomat and !u.flags2.resident and !u.flags3.ghostly and
!u.curse.add_tags1.OPPOSED_TO_LIFE and !u.curse.add_tags1.CRAZED and
u.mood != :Berserk
# TODO check curse ; currently this should keep vampires, but may include werebeasts
}
end
# list workers (citizen, not crazy / child / inmood / noble)
def unit_workers
unit_citizens.find_all { |u|
u.mood == :None and
u.profession != :CHILD and
u.profession != :BABY and
# TODO MENIAL_WORK_EXEMPTION_SPOUSE
!unit_entitypositions(u).find { |pos| pos.flags[:MENIAL_WORK_EXEMPTION] }
}
end
# list currently idle workers
def unit_idlers
unit_workers.find_all { |u|
# current_job includes eat/drink/sleep/pickupequip
!u.job.current_job and
# filter 'attend meeting'
u.meetings.length == 0 and
# filter soldiers (TODO check schedule)
u.military.squad_index == -1 and
# filter 'on break'
!u.status.misc_traits.find { |t| id == :OnBreak }
}
end
def unit_entitypositions(unit)
list = []
return list if not hf = world.history.figures.binsearch(unit.hist_figure_id)
hf.entity_links.each { |el|
next if el._rtti_classname != :histfig_entity_link_positionst
next if not ent = world.entities.all.binsearch(el.entity_id)
next if not pa = ent.positions.assignments.binsearch(el.assignment_id)
next if not pos = ent.positions.own.binsearch(pa.position_id)
list << pos
}
list
end
end
end
